DENVER, CO – After losing to the Colorado Avalanche 4-1 on Sunday wasn’t bad enough for the Los Angeles Kings, a weather storm prevented the team from from flying back to Los Angeles. Due to the delay, the Kings game against the St. Louis Blues at Staples Center on Monday night was postponed.

The Kings will face the Blues on Wednesday night at Staples Center, and no announcement for a rescheduled date has been made by the NHL.
